Matomo is a real product. Here's the trade.
Matomo is genuinely powerful and self-hostable, which is fantastic if your team enjoys running PHP servers. If you don't, Matomo Cloud gets pricey fast — and you still need to configure most of the features manually. Ghaze is a SaaS-only alternative that's faster to install and cheaper at the small-business price point.
When Matomo is the better pick
- If your data must live on servers your team controls (defence, gov, regulated finance), Matomo's self-host is the right answer.
- If you want full GA Universal-Analytics import compatibility, Matomo has the most mature import pipeline.
